55
93
+ 1
58

What is CapRover?

It is an extremely easy to use app/database deployment & web server manager for your NodeJS, Python, PHP, ASP.NET, Ruby, MySQL, MongoDB, Postgres, WordPress (and etc...) applications! It's blazingly fast and very robust as it uses Docker, nginx, LetsEncrypt and NetData under the hood behind its simple-to-use interface.
CapRover is a tool in the Platform as a Service category of a tech stack.
CapRover is an open source tool with 12.1K GitHub stars and 772 GitHub forks. Here’s a link to CapRover's open source repository on GitHub

Who uses CapRover?

Companies
8 companies reportedly use CapRover in their tech stacks, including identi, Smoove Xperience, and Coinsamba.

Developers
47 developers on StackShare have stated that they use CapRover.

CapRover Integrations

Python, Node.js, Docker, MySQL, and PHP are some of the popular tools that integrate with CapRover. Here's a list of all 12 tools that integrate with CapRover.
Pros of CapRover
13
Opensource
12
Mangage complex infrastructure easily
9
Auto SSL
7
Docker
7
Easy instalation
5
Auto load balancing
3
Gitlab entegration
2
Easy to use PAAS

CapRover's Features

  • CLI for automation and scripting
  • Web GUI for ease of access and convenience
  • No lock-in! Remove CapRover and your apps keep working!
  • Docker Swarm under the hood for containerization and clustering
  • Nginx (fully customizable template) under the hood for load-balancing
  • Let's Encrypt under the hood for free SSL (HTTPS)

CapRover Alternatives & Comparisons

What are some alternatives to CapRover?
Heroku
Heroku is a cloud application platform – a new way of building and deploying web apps. Heroku lets app developers spend 100% of their time on their application code, not managing servers, deployment, ongoing operations, or scaling.
Kubernetes
Kubernetes is an open source orchestration system for Docker containers. It handles scheduling onto nodes in a compute cluster and actively manages workloads to ensure that their state matches the users declared intentions.
Google App Engine
Google has a reputation for highly reliable, high performance infrastructure. With App Engine you can take advantage of the 10 years of knowledge Google has in running massively scalable, performance driven systems. App Engine applications are easy to build, easy to maintain, and easy to scale as your traffic and data storage needs grow.
Apollo
Build a universal GraphQL API on top of your existing REST APIs, so you can ship new application features fast without waiting on backend changes.
AWS Elastic Beanstalk
Once you upload your application, Elastic Beanstalk automatically handles the deployment details of capacity provisioning, load balancing, auto-scaling, and application health monitoring.
See all alternatives

CapRover's Followers
93 developers follow CapRover to keep up with related blogs and decisions.